Who Founded the Episcopal Church: Unveiling the Origins!

The origins of the Episcopal Church can be traced back to the Protestant Reformation in the 16th century. However, it was not until the American Revolution that the church was officially established. The key figures involved in its founding include Samuel Seabury, William White, and Thomas Claggett. Baptism Beliefs: What Pentecostal Churches Believe About Baptism

Baptism holds significant importance for Pentecostal churches, as it symbolizes the believer’s commitment to Christ. According to Pentecostal belief, baptism involves full immersion in water, representing the cleansing of sins and spiritual rebirth. It is viewed as a public declaration of one’s faith and receipt of the Holy Spirit. While baptism does not guarantee salvation, it is seen as a vital step in one’s spiritual journey. Additionally, Pentecostals emphasize the role of baptism in uniting believers with Christ and the church community.
